Output 53831a876b05398122174cca5ede7688beb21af0050d84e5fcf70b0935594f03:0

value
10483472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ac6a5916bf67655c1a824de32367fb16c209ecc OP_EQUAL
address
3JibaScSPU6hMggNgeaL56QSC9FYaJzFWL
transaction
53831a876b05398122174cca5ede7688beb21af0050d84e5fcf70b0935594f03
spent
true